Kapil Dev slams Rohit, Virat and Rahul for flopping in must-win T20 matches: Former Indian skipper, Kapil Dev has slammed team India’s top three batters – Rohit Sharma, Virat Kohli and KL Rahul – for not coming good at crucial moments in the T20 cricket. Dev didn’t mince his words as he hit out at the three most reputed current Indian batters to play with clarity in mind.

Notably, Indian all format skipper Rohit Sharma had a forgettable outing in the recently finished Tata IPL 2022 and so does former skipper Virat Kohli. While Sharma only managed to score 268 runs, Kohli amassed 341 runs in 16 innings. Meanwhile, KL Rahul continued his scintillating touch in the IPL. The LSG skipper scored 616 runs from 15 matches and remained at number two in the orange cap table.

Kapil Dev slams Rohit, Virat and Rahul

Talking about the performances of India’s first-choice top three in the shortest format, the 1983 World Cup-winning captain said that the above-mentioned players need to play a fearless brand of cricket.

“They have a big reputation and there’s huge pressure on them, which shouldn’t be the case. You have to play fearless cricket. All of these are players who can hit at a strike rate of 150-160. Whenever we need them to score runs, they all get out. When it is time to take off (in the innings), they are out. And that adds to pressure. Either you play an anchor or you play striker,” Kapil Dev said on the YouTube channel Uncut.

Dev, 63, further talked about the role of KL Rahul in the side. He asserted that a player can’t return with a score of unbeaten 60 after playing all 20 overs.

“When you talk about KL Rahul, if the team tells him to play the entire 20 overs and you come back with a score of, say 60 not out, you’re not doing justice to your team,” said Kapil.

“I think the approach needs to change. And if it doesn’t, you have to change the players. A big player is expected to make a big impact. Having a big reputation is not enough, you also have to deliver great performances.”

India vs South Africa T20Is:

Meanwhile, team India will return to action once again on June 9 as the Men in Blue host their South African counterparts for the five matches T20I series. The shortest format series will kickstart on June 9 in Delhi’s Arun Jaitley Stadium. 

Notably, the senior players such as Rohit Sharma, Virat Kohli, Jasprit Bumrah and Mohammad Shami have been rested for the series. In Rohit’s absence, KL Rahul will have the commanding role. Glovesman Rishabh Pant will be Rahul’s deputy for the series.
